Mr. Brestel to Attend Workshop at Cornell University
April 21, 2008
Holdrege High School physics teacher Tom Brestel has been selected as one of twenty physics teachers nationally to attend a summer workshop at the Center for Nanoscale Systems at Cornell University in Ithaca New York. The two week workshop includes lectures by Cornell faculty, hands-on laboratory activities, content designed to update high school teachers on recent advances in physics. Topics of study include, atomic-scale imaging, integrated circuits, and X-ray diffraction of biomolecules.
